Why Air Duct Cleaning Benefits Your Health
Did you know that most of the toxins we breathe in every day come from inside our homes? That’s right.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), some pollutants are 2 to 5 times higher indoors than outdoors. Since we spend about 90% of our time indoors, that’s a scary thought.
